Contents

This is an introduction to COMSOL Multiphysics and the AC/DC Module with a focus on statics (DC) and low frequency / inductive (AC) modeling. You will learn how to build models in Electrostatics, Magnetostatics and low frequency AC applications. The course also gives an introduction to multiphysics involving electromagnetic phenomena. It allows current and potential users of COMSOL Multiphysics and the AC/DC Module to quickly get acquainted with its modelling capabilities.

  • Magnetostatic fields of permanent magnets and current carrying wires
  • Special boundary conditions for infinity and shielding.
  • Resistance, inductance, and capacitance calculations
  • Electromotive forces in generators and motors
  • Nonlinear materials (e.g. B-H-curves)
  • Eddy current effects
  • Resistive and inductive heating

Speaker

Dr. Sven Friedel
COMSOL Multiphysics GmbH, Zurich

Dr. Sven Friedel is a physicist and earned his Ph.D. at the University of Leipzig (Germany) in geophysics, specializing in electromagnetic inverse problems applied to tomographic imaging. He also taught courses in, among other things, geomagnetics. For his research he focused on the simulation of electrical, fluidic, and thermal processes in volcanoes. After several years working as a postdoctoral researcher in the area of geotechnical engineering at the ETH in Zurich, in 2004 Dr. Friedel established COMSOL AB's branch office in Switzerland.
